ION Publishing LtdNanoposts.com provides nanotechnology scouting and transfer services and foresight exercises for some of the world’s largest companies, including Glaverbel, Shell and Mantrose Haueser. Nanoposts.com is provides intelligence for industry on nanotechnologies that may affect their products, and identify researchers, research groups and technologies within companies that may be relevant to their product portfolio. Each year, apart from initiating its own reports, Nanoposts.com completes around eight market intelligence contracts for publicly quoted companies and government bodies. Nanoposts.com produces a portfolio of commercial reports on nanotechnology activities worldwide. |
